Transaction 35f900b20821bf756a18bb8da5175094556502ae8b71e14f06647fd5262e41b8
1 Input
1 Output
-
35f900b20821bf756a18bb8da5175094556502ae8b71e14f06647fd5262e41b8:0
- value
- 250874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f043ae8efa3022e817c6797c6d2eb57baa7c0d57 OP_EQUAL
- address
- 3PbRBCezfr63BQNRy7DYqVSjEJdz7yRqn2